Facebook reportedly tried to buy software to spy on iPhone users

<p class="">Here’s another reason to dislike Facebook (the world’s frenemy): according to <a href="https://www.documentcloud.org/documents/6824735-Declaration-of-Shalev-Hulio-in-Support-of.html"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">a declaration from NSO CEO Shalev Hulio</a>, two Facebook representatives approached NSO in October 2017 and asked to purchase the right to use certain capabilities of Pegasus. In other words, the company wanted to buy an Apple spying tool, according to <a href="https://www.vice.com/en_us/article/pke9k9/facebook-wanted-nso-spyware-to-monitor-users"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Motherboard</a>.</p>

All Apple retail stores in the U.S. to remain closed until early May

<p class=""><a href="https://www.bloomberg.com/news/articles/2020-04-03/apple-tells-staff-u-s-stores-to-remain-closed-until-early-may?sref=9hGJlFio"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Bloomberg</a> reports that Deirdre O’Brien, Apple’s senior vice president of Retail + People, told employees in a memo that its retail stores in the U.S. will remain closed and work-from-home procedures will stay in place until early May due to the COVID-19 pandemic. All the stores outside the Greater China area were closed on March 17.</p>

FreeConferenceCall.com looks like a viable alternative to Zoom

<p class="">Conferencing usage has skyrocketed in the last three weeks with <a href="http://freeconferencecall.com/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">FreeConferenceCall.com</a> reporting a nearly 700% increase in new customer sign-ups the week of March 22 (vs. sign-ups from the week of Feb. 23). It also looks as if it could be a viable alternative to the <a href="https://appleworld.dreamhosters.com/blog/2020/4/1/zoom-sued-for-security-failures-so-its-time-for-apple-to-open-source-facettime?rq=Zoom"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">trouble-plagued Zoom</a>.</p>
